Who buys Industrial Building Construction for the federal government?

Federal agencies obligated $1.5B on Industrial Building Construction (NAICS 236210) in prime contracts in FY2024 — the #55 most-contracted federal NAICS. Below are the states where it's a leading category; open any state for its full picture.
